ValueError when attempting to import a .SMD
Python: Traceback (most recent call last): File "//import_smd.py", line 72, in execute self.num_files_imported = self.readSMD(filepath, self.properties.upAxis, self.properties.rotMode) File "//import_smd.py", line 1239, in readSMD if line == "nodes\n": self.readNodes() File "//import_smd.py", line 254, in readNodes id, name, parent = self.parseQuoteBlockedLine(line,lower=False)[:3] ValueError: not enough values to unpack (expected 3, got 2) location: <unknown location>:-1

If I convert the .smd model to a .obj via a different program, it will work and appear just fine. Not sure what might be causing this. Using Blender 2.91
